This PR modifies the default bootstrap template to support EMR Serverless containers.

Without this policy, containers created using the DockerImageAsset construct cannot be used with EMR Serverless applications.

There is precedence for this pattern to support Lambda function containers, so I don't think this should be too controversial of a change.
